**Vendor note: Inkmill markdown pipeline**

Rendering for Parchway docs is outsourced to Inkmill under an annual contract, renewing each March. They handle sanitization and PDF export; we own the upload queue. SLA: 4-hour response on rendering failures. Escalate only after two failed retries. Their support desk is reachable at the address below.

billing contact of hahaf-baguf = zorael.tammir.jorius@sivrelhq.internal

## Configuration

The Tumblecrest locker service handles the laundry drop-off and pickup flow for the Waverly Heights pilot. Locker unlock requests are signed server-side and expire after sixty seconds. Before tagging a release, confirm the env file sets the locker firmware channel to stable, then place the signing secret on the line directly after this paragraph.

vault entry, yahif-yajep: COURIER_KEY29=b802bdf8034096b65a51c6ba5abe2

TURN-208: Gatevale turnstile counters at the Merrow Field pilot double-count when a rotation reverses mid-cycle. Attendance totals drift roughly 2% high per event. The debounce window fix is implemented, reviewed by Ilsa, and soak-tested across two simulated match days without drift. Ready for your cut; the candidate build is identified below.

trace token, tagag-tafog: htk6_5ed18c

## Further reading

FeedCheck validates podcast RSS against the Larkmont profile, including enclosure size limits and signature verification on remote artwork. Security reviewers should pay particular attention to the XML entity-expansion guards and the redirect-depth cap in the fetcher. Threat model notes, past audit findings, and the fuzzing corpus description are collected on the internal page.

operations page: https://vault.qirvanhq.local/ticket

## Runbook: DeployBuddy Bot

DeployBuddy is the chat bot that answers "is my deploy done yet?" in the #ship-it channel. It polls the Conveyor pipeline every 30 seconds and posts status changes. If it goes quiet, first check that the poller pod in the Tallgrass cluster is running — nine times out of ten that's the culprit. Restart with `buddyctl restart poller`. If the bot responds but shows stale data, its Conveyor token has probably rotated. It authenticates to the Conveyor status API with the key below.

API key for yahig-tadup: kto7_ubizbYm